Node Server Memcached Protocol
for logging users in and out of the server.
-------------------------------------------
add <username> <!ignore flags> <!ignore exptime> <bytes> [!ignore noreply]\r\n
- <username> is the username of the new user
- <flags> and <exptime> are ignored.
- <bytes> is the number of bytes in the data block to follow, *not*
including the delimiting \r\n. <bytes> may *not* be zero.
After this line, the client sends the JSON-encoded data block:
<data block>\r\n
- <data block> is JSON-encoded information about the user, having a length
of <bytes> bytes.
After sending the command line and the data block, the client awaits
the reply, which may be:
- "STORED\r\n", to indicate that the user is or has been logged in.
- "NOT_STORED\r\n", to indicate that there was a problem storing the
new user data.
Retrieval command:
------------------
The retrieval commands "get" and "gets" operates like this:
get <type/identifier>\r\n
gets <type/identifier> <type/identifier> <...>\r\n
- <type/identifier> is one of:
- session/<session_id> where <session_id> is the session of an
existing user.
> returns information about the user
- username/<username> where <username> is the (properly formatted)
username of a logged in user.
> returns information about the user
- list/
> returns a list of all online users
- online/
> returns an integer value of the online user count
After this command, the client expects zero or more items, each of
which is received as a text line followed by a data block. After all
the items have been transmitted, the server sends the string
"END\r\n"
to indicate the end of response.
Each item sent by the server looks like this:
VALUE <key> <flags> <bytes>\r\n
<data block>\r\n
- <key> is the key for the item being sent
- <flags> is set to 0
- <bytes> is the length of the data block to follow, *not* including
its delimiting \r\n
- <data block> is the data for this response, usually in JSON format (exception: online/).
If some of the keys appearing in a retrieval request are not sent back
by the server in the item list this means that the server does not
hold items with such keys (because they were never stored, or stored
but deleted to make space for more items, or expired, or explicitly
deleted by a client).
Logging out
--------
The command "delete" allows for explicit logging out of users:
delete <username>\r\n
- <username> is the username of the user the client wishes the server
to log out.
The response line to this command can be one of:
- "DELETED\r\n" to indicate success
- "NOT_FOUND\r\n" to indicate that the user with this username was not
found.

// == Node.js Server Configuration ==
//
// This is the configuration file for the Node.js Ajax IM server. Here, you
// can set which ports will be used for the public and internal servers,
// as well as other settings such as the session cookie name and expiration.
// === {{{ ports }}} ===
//
// Define the ports and hosts that Ajax IM will run on. {{{public}}} is the
// public-facing API, while {{{private}}} is the memcache-compatible API
// intended for server-side use.
//
// The first item of each array is the port, the second is the host name. If
// you do not want to specify a host, set it to {{{null}}}.
exports.ports = {
public: [8000, 'localhost'],
private: [11998, 'localhost']
};
// === {{{ cookie }}} ===
//
// Define the cookie name and how long a session will be stored on the server.
// If you change the cookie name here, you will also need to change it in the
// PHP login script/configuration; if you fail to do this, the Node.js server
// will be looking for a cookie that does not exist.
//
// **Note:** The period for the session should be as long or longer than the
// cookie itself is set to be stored. If it is less, the user won't be logged
// back in automatically, as their cookie will have been deleted.
exports.cookie = {
name: 'ajaxim_session',
period: 8760
};
